  49. /****************************************************************************
  50. * Name: readdir_r
  51. *
  52. * Description:
  53. * The readdir() function returns a pointer to a dirent
  54. * structure representing the next directory entry in the
  55. * directory stream pointed to by dir. It returns NULL on
  56. * reaching the end-of-file or if an error occurred.
  57. *
  58. * Input Parameters:
  59. * dirp -- An instance of type DIR created by a previous
  60. * call to opendir();
  61. * entry -- The storage pointed to by entry must be large
  62. * enough for a dirent with an array of char d_name
  63. * members containing at least {NAME_MAX}+1 elements.
  64. * result -- Upon successful return, the pointer returned
  65. * at *result shall have the same value as the
  66. * argument entry. Upon reaching the end of the directory
  67. * stream, this pointer shall have the value NULL.
  68. *
  69. * Returned Value:
  70. * If successful, the readdir_r() function return s zero;
  71. * otherwise, an error number is returned to indicate the
  72. * error.
  73. *
  74. * EBADF - Invalid directory stream descriptor dir
  75. *
  76. ****************************************************************************/
  77. int readdir_r(FAR DIR *dirp, FAR struct dirent *entry,
  78. FAR struct dirent **result)
  79. {
  80. struct dirent *tmp;
  81. /* NOTE: The following use or errno is *not* thread-safe */
  82. set_errno(0);
  83. tmp = readdir(dirp);
  84. if (!tmp)
  85. {
  86. int error = get_errno();
  87. if (!error)
  88. {
  89. if (result)
  90. {
  91. *result = NULL;
  92. }
  93. return 0;
  94. }
  95. else
  96. {
  97. return error;
  98. }
  99. }
  100. if (entry)
  101. {
  102. memcpy(entry, tmp, sizeof(struct dirent));
  103. }
  104. if (result)
  105. {
  106. *result = entry;
  107. }
  108. return 0;
  109. }
